Where Does Lion Rock Group Stand in the Ecosystem?

Lion Rock Group Limited sits as a niche publisher and distributor, not a gatekeeper. Its Lion Rock Group brand position is defensible only when content stays relevant and channel access stays reliable, so its power is selective rather than structural.

Icon

Structural Position in the Publishing Ecosystem

Lion Rock Group Limited sits between content selection and end-market delivery. In the Lion Rock Group competitive analysis, that means it can shape what gets packaged and moved, but it does not control the broader platform, pricing, or distribution rails.

Against larger platforms and better-capitalized publishers, the Lion Rock Group vs competitors picture points to specialization, not dominance. That is why the company's Lion Rock Group brand equity depends more on execution, relationships, and catalogue fit than on scale power.

Who Competes With Lion Rock Group for Power in the Same System?

Lion Rock Group Limited competes with traditional publishers, digital-first content providers, self-publishing systems, and the platforms that control reader attention. Bookstores, online marketplaces, search feeds, social feeds, and reading apps shape discovery, so Lion Rock Group brand position is tied to channels as much as to content.

Icon Platform control is the strongest structural rival

In a Lion Rock Group competitive analysis, the biggest pressure comes from platform intermediaries that own audience attention. Search engines, marketplaces, and social feeds decide what gets seen first, so Lion Rock Group competitors are not only publisher brands but also the systems that mediate discovery and conversion.

What Gives Lion Rock Group an Ecosystem Advantage?

Lion Rock Group Limited's ecosystem edge comes from its spread across books, magazines, publishing-related services, and distribution. That gives Lion Rock Group Limited more route-to-market touchpoints, steadier audience access, and better reach across educational, leisure, and lifestyle demand than many Lion Rock Group competitors.

Structural Advantage How It Helps the Company Why It Matters
Multi-format footprint Operates across books, magazines, publishing services, and distribution. This lowers dependence on one format and supports wider demand capture in Lion Rock Group industry comparison.
Broad content mix Covers educational, leisure, and lifestyle themes. That widens Lion Rock Group brand position and gives the business more than one customer use case.
Route-to-market control Combines content selection with delivery and distribution links. Control over access and execution can strengthen Lion Rock Group brand strength even when Lion Rock Group competitor brands are crowded.

The strongest structural advantage looks like route-to-market control, because access and execution often matter more than simple title count. What Does the Competitive Outlook Say About Lion Rock Group's Position?

Lion Rock Group Limited is more likely to defend a niche role than gain broad structural power. The Lion Rock Group brand position can stay relevant where curated print, editorial trust, and channel access still matter, but digital substitution and fragmented attention limit long run Lion Rock Group brand strength against larger, more scalable Lion Rock Group competitors.

Icon Strongest future support: niche trust and curated content

The clearest support for Lion Rock Group brand equity is specialization. In a Lion Rock Group brand comparison, focused titles and curated print can still attract readers who value depth, reliability, and a physical format.
